International Medical Corps Recruitment for HR / Admin Intern

International Medical Corps is a global, humanitarian, nonprofit organization dedicated to saving lives and relieving suffering through health care training and relief and development programs. Established in 1984 by volunteer doctors and Nurses, International Medical Corps is a private, voluntary, nonpolitical, nonsectarian organization. Its mission is to improve the quality of life through health interventions and related activities that build local capacity in under-served communities worldwide.

Job Position: HR / Admin Intern

Job Location: Abuja 
Job Type: Full Time

Scope of Work


  • The intern will support the HR/Admin department in the day-to-day management of the Abuja office. In this position the intern is expected to learn and support on the department’s daily administration routines and procedures while also focusing on the IMC’s overall mission.

HR Related:

  • Assist with onboarding and orientation of new hires in Abuja office.
  • Documentation of new hires and file management
  • Support with Scanning documents and updating the online staff database.
  • Support with Filing, labelling of all files accordingly of hard copies of staff document.
  • Support with compilation of Health Insurance and Life Insurance Documents

Administration:

  • Assist in coordinating booking and tracking of travels and accommodation as well & documentation of payment documents.
  • Assist in following up with immigration and related statutory agencies for staff working and traveling permit
  • Scanning of approved documents for relevant documentation and classifying in respective soft/hard file.
  • Support in maintaining and managing IMC offices and guest houses, ensuring a clean, organized, and conducive working environment, and in accordance with relevant SOPs.
  • Report to HR/Admin Officer on any repairs or equipment servicing.
  • Support in mmanaging and supervising the cleaners and cook.
  • Assist in organizing and coordinating meetings, workshops, and other events.

Documentation and Records Management:

  • Assist and maintain efficient filing systems for both physical and electronic records on administrative matters.
  • Support in ensuring proper documentation of official communications, reports, and other relevant documents.
  • Support archiving processes and facilitate retrieval of records as needed.

Financial Administration, Payments, and Reconciliation:

  • Assist in coordination with the finance team to ensure timely and accurate financial transactions for vendor payments.
  • Prepare payments for staff hotel accommodation and follow up on reconciliation between Finance and relevant vendors.
